Cowboys linebacker Keith Brooking says there are plenty of people in the Falcons organization that he still cares about deeply, but he said jokingly he still wants to "bash their heads in" Sunday. The Senoia, Ga native played 11 seasons for the Falcons, after graduating from Georgia Tech. He's all about Atlanta football. He's also incredibly emotional on the football field: see his head-butt into the chest of linebackers coach Reggie Herring after a key 4th down stop in the Denver game. Brooking says he'll have to be measured emotionally against a familar foe, "I have played in big time games before where I do get too emotional, too pumped up and it kinda takes me out of my game," he said. "So, I've gotta be mentally sharp to where the emotion doesn't take me out of that part of my game, and just play football." Brooking also notes its a conference game and it'll be big come the end of the season when the playoff picture develops more. I'll be watching him on the sidelines; I'm expecting a show. |
